FOUR CHILDREN DROWNED
(UNITED PRSSB ASSOCIATION.)
ABHBURTON, October 18.
A sad caae of drowning occurred last night. The river had been in flood. for the foot few days, and the fords were in bad order. A man namtd Jenkins, his wife, ;and four children were out for a drive in a trap, and tried to ford the river. The trap upset, and all the children and the hone were drownifl, But Jenkim and his wife managed to crawl out.
